Using Ordafy's Sales Interface

Ordafy provides two ways to record sale customers:

Web Interface (Desktop/Laptop)

Access the Sales Interface from your product dashboard:

  • Navigate to your product and click "Sales"
  • Enter order/booking reference manually in the search field
  • Press Enter or click "Record sale" to process
  • View real-time statistics updated every 10 seconds
  • See overall progress and statistics by variant or type
  • View customer details after successful sales

Mobile App (QR Code Scanning)

Use Ordafy's mobile app for QR code scanning:

  • Open the Sales screen in the Ordafy mobile app
  • Grant camera permissions when prompted
  • Tap to open the QR code scanner
  • Scan QR codes from orders or bookings (digital or printed)
  • System automatically processes sales
  • Haptic feedback and sound confirm successful sales
  • View real-time statistics updated every 30 seconds
  • Works offline - saless queue and sync when online

Monitoring Sales Progress

Track sales in real-time using Ordafy's statistics:

  • Overall Statistics: View total orders/bookings, checked-in count, remaining, and percentage
  • By Variant/Type: See sales progress for each variant or type separately
  • Real-time Updates: Statistics refresh automatically (web: every 10 seconds, mobile: every 30 seconds)
  • Progress Bars: Visual representation of sales progress
  • Manual Refresh: Click refresh button to update statistics immediately
  • Export sales data during or after the order fulfillment is completed from your customer list

Offline Sales (Mobile App)

Ordafy's mobile sales app works offline:

  • Saless are queued locally when offline
  • Queue syncs automatically when connectivity is restored
  • No data is lost during temporary connectivity issues
  • View offline queue in the app to see pending saless
  • Test offline functionality before your order fulfillment
  • Ensure devices have the latest app version

Sales Results

After checking in a customer, you'll see:

  • Success Message: Confirmation that sales was successful
  • Customer Details: Name, email, variant/type, reference number, order number
  • Sales Time: Timestamp of when sales occurred
  • Error Messages: Clear messages if sales fails (e.g. order not found, already sold)
